Cost of Living Comparison Between Sale and Casablanca Cost of Living Comparison Between Sale and Casablanca

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$665 in Sale versus $1,045 in Casablanca.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$1,096 in Sale versus $1,601 in Casablanca.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$1,528 in Sale versus $2,156 in Casablanca.

Living in Sale costs roughly 36% less than in Casablanca, driven mainly by Eating Out.

Both cities sit below the global median: Sale 52% lower, Casablanca 24% lower.

Cost Breakdown

A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$220 in Sale and $636 in Casablanca.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.

Casablanca pays 28% more on average. The extra income cushions the higher costs, though housing choices and lifestyle decide how much of the gap is truly closed.

Dining out: $19.00 in Sale vs $32.00 in Casablanca for a mid-range dinner for two. Groceries echo the gap at $201 vs $219 per month, with Sale cheaper across the board.
